Cast Iron Coding was created in fall 2004 by longtime colleagues Zach Davis and Lucas Thurston. Zach and Lucas had been working on a freelance basis, and Cast Iron Coding is the product of their decision to start working as a team. After 6 years of life in New York, Zach moved to Portland in 2006 to bring the team under the same roof. Since its early days, Cast Iron Coding has expanded to include a network of artists, designers, and partner agencies. For more information, please contact us.
